Behind the Scenes of a Traveling Circus: More Than Just a Life of Glamour

Life Under the Big Top

Traveling circuses have long captivated audiences with their dazzling performances and exotic acts. However, as someone who has spent considerable time with these artistic communities, I can attest to the intricate balance they must maintain between their work and personal lives.

"Traveling the world sounds glamorous, but the reality can be far more complex. It's a rich tapestry of human experience filled with highs and lows."

The Allure of the Circus

As a child, the circus was synonymous with adventure. Brightly colored tents, the smell of popcorn, and the thrill of acrobatics filled my senses. But behind those stunning visuals lies a challenging lifestyle built on rigorous routines, extensive travel, and a need for adaptability.

Challenges Beyond the Spotlight

While many view circus life through a romantic lens, the day-to-day is often a grind. Performers frequently deal with:

  • Long hours of practice
  • Unpredictable schedules
  • Physical stamina challenges
  • Emotional stress from constant travel

For these artists, the sacrifices often outweigh the perceived glamor of their profession.

Building Community on the Road

The essence of circus life extends beyond individual acts; it's about forging a community. Cast and crew members become a surrogate family. They share experiences, support one another through challenges, and celebrate milestones together. This dynamic creates a unique bond that's essential for surviving the rigors of this lifestyle.

The Economics of Circus Life

From an economic perspective, the circus industry faces several challenges:

  1. Rising operational costs
  2. Competition from other entertainment mediums
  3. Changing audience preferences

As someone keenly aware of business dynamics, I observe that this industry must innovate to maintain relevance in a rapidly changing market.

The Future of the Circus

Despite the hurdles, there's a renewed interest in circus arts, especially with the rise of innovative circuses that blend traditional acts with modern technology. The future holds promise for those who can adapt and reinvent the experience for new generations.

Conclusion: More Than Entertainment

The traveling circus is not merely an entertainment venue; it is a microcosm of societal rhythms and personal sacrifices. As we explore this world, we must recognize the dedication that goes into every performance. It is vital to appreciate not just the spectacle but also the story behind each artist's journey.
